OverviewThe Early Modern Period in Germany 1620-1720 extends the dictionary of authors tradition into the 18th century. The dictionary aims to illuminate the literary forms, dynamics, and debates of the past. Each article offers a biographical portrait while also analyzing and contextualizing the author's works. The articles, which are based on primary sources, also provide details concerning manuscripts, print publications, and research literature. Since the Dictionary of Authors 'The Early Modern Era in Germany 1620-1720' is part of the Verfasserdatenbank (Database of Authors), single issues are not available as e-books.
